Lets compare vitamin content per 1 kilogram of Tomatoes in Juice with Salt vs Canned Sweet Potato, Vacuum Pack:
Canned Red Ripe Tomatoes in Tomato Juice with Salt have 15.5 times more Vitamin B1 than Canned Sweet Potato, Vacuum Pack.
While Canned Sweet Potato, Vacuum Pack contains 20 times more Vitamin A, 4.5 times more Vitamin B5, 1.7 times more Vitamin B6, 2.1 times more Vitamin B9, 2.1 times more Vitamin C and 1.7 times more Vitamin E than Canned Red Ripe Tomatoes in Tomato Juice with Salt.
Both Canned Red Ripe Tomatoes in Tomato Juice with Salt and Canned Sweet Potato, Vacuum Pack have similar amounts of Vitamin B2, Vitamin B3 and Vitamin K per 1 kg.
Both Canned Red Ripe Tomatoes in Tomato Juice with Salt as well as Canned Sweet Potato, Vacuum Pack have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in 1 kg.
Comparing minerals per 1 kilogram for Tomatoes in Juice with Salt vs Canned Sweet Potato, Vacuum Pack:
Canned Red Ripe Tomatoes in Tomato Juice with Salt have 1.5 times more Calcium, 2.2 times more Sodium and 1.2 times more Water than Canned Sweet Potato, Vacuum Pack.
While Canned Sweet Potato, Vacuum Pack contains 2.7 times more Copper, 1.6 times more Iron, 2.2 times more Magnesium, 6.7 times more Manganese, 2.9 times more Phosphorus, 1.6 times more Potassium and 1.5 times more Zinc than Canned Red Ripe Tomatoes in Tomato Juice with Salt.
Both Canned Red Ripe Tomatoes in Tomato Juice with Salt and Canned Sweet Potato, Vacuum Pack have similar amounts of Selenium per 1 kg.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 1 kilogram:
Canned Sweet Potato, Vacuum Pack contains 5.7 times more Energy, 6.1 times more Carbohydrate, 2 times more Sugars and 2.1 times more Protein than Canned Red Ripe Tomatoes in Tomato Juice with Salt.
Both Canned Red Ripe Tomatoes in Tomato Juice with Salt and Canned Sweet Potato, Vacuum Pack have similar amounts of Fiber per 1 kg.
Both Canned Red Ripe Tomatoes in Tomato Juice with Salt as well as Canned Sweet Potato, Vacuum Pack have insufficient amounts of Fat, Omega 3, Omega 6, Cholesterol, Glucose and Sucrose in 1 kg.
